The Core Concept of Insurance
Insurance functions by pooling risks, allowing individuals and businesses to transfer potential financial losses to insurers in exchange for premiums. This mechanism ensures that unexpected costs, whether from illness, accidents, or natural disasters, do not overwhelm savings or disrupt financial stability.
Main Types of Insurance in 2024
Health Insurance
Health insurance remains essential as medical expenses rise globally. Modern policies often include preventive care, chronic illness management, and telemedicine coverage, expanding access to healthcare.
Life Insurance
Life insurance continues to provide financial security to beneficiaries. In 2024, hybrid products combining life coverage with investment features are increasingly popular, supporting both immediate protection and long-term wealth planning.
Property and Casualty Insurance
Property insurance protects against damage caused by fires, thefts, and natural disasters, while casualty insurance covers liability for accidents. With climate change increasing extreme weather events, demand for property coverage is higher than ever.
Auto Insurance
Automobile insurance remains mandatory in most regions, offering coverage for accidents, damages, and liabilities. Advances in electric and autonomous vehicles are reshaping policy structures in 2024.
Business and Cyber Insurance
Businesses rely on insurance to ensure continuity. Cyber insurance has become increasingly important as data breaches and online threats escalate, providing coverage for digital vulnerabilities and regulatory compliance.

Challenges Facing the Industry
The insurance industry in 2024 faces rising premiums, accessibility concerns, and complex policy structures that can confuse consumers. Climate-related claims and cyberattacks also place pressure on insurers. These challenges require innovation, transparency, and stronger risk management frameworks.
Technology and the Future of Insurance
Digital transformation is reshaping the industry. AI-powered underwriting, blockchain-based claims verification, and online comparison tools enhance efficiency and transparency. While these innovations improve access and speed, they also demand robust cybersecurity to protect sensitive customer data.
